Abstract

The invention relates to an aluminoborosilicate glass devoid of alkali, which has the following composition (in wt. % relative to the oxide content): SiO>58-70; BO0.5-<9; AlO10-25; MgO>8-15; CaO 0-<10; SrO 0-<3; BaO 0-<2; with MgO+CaO+SrO+BaO>8-18; ZnO 0-<2. Said glass is eminently suitable for use as substrate glass, both in display technology and in thin-film photovoltaic technology.
